60 Tons of Humanitarian Aid from Vietnam to Iran

Vietnam has reportedly sent approximately 60 tons of humanitarian aid to Iran. The cargo aircraft carrying the aid supplies departed from Hanoi and arrived in Iran without any issues.

The shipment reportedly included rice, flour, instant noodles, fish sauce, sugar, and various food products, as well as clothing for children and adults and other basic necessities.

Vietnamese authorities stated that the aid was prepared in line with instructions from the country’s leadership and aims to support the humanitarian needs in Iran.

It was reported that the aircraft’s departure and landing processes were completed smoothly, and the shipment was delivered to Iranian officials. The aid is intended to help meet basic food and daily needs.

This humanitarian shipment between the two countries took place at a time when tensions in the region continue and humanitarian needs are increasing.
